Specifications

  • Filter Media: PVDF (Polyvinylidene Fluoride), known for its low protein binding and broad chemical compatibility. This makes it suitable for filtering a wide range of solutions without significant analyte loss.
  • Pore Size: 0.45 µm, effectively removes bacteria and particulate matter from samples. This pore size is a standard for many analytical applications.
  • Sterility: Nonsterile, suitable for general laboratory filtration where sterility is not a primary concern. For applications requiring sterile filtration, alternative sterile options would be needed.
  • Whatman No.: 6765-1304, the unique product identifier for easy reordering and referencing. This ensures you get the exact same filter every time.
  • Unit: Pack of 2000, providing a large supply for high-throughput laboratories or frequent users. This is ideal for long-term projects or environments where filtration is a daily necessity.
  • Diameter: 13 mm, appropriate for sample volumes up to 10mL. This size offers a good balance between filtration efficiency and ease of use.

These specifications are crucial because they directly impact the quality and reliability of the filtered samples. The PVDF membrane ensures minimal interaction with the sample, preserving its integrity. The 0.45 µm pore size guarantees effective removal of contaminants.
